Charlotte M. McGoldrick
August 2nd, 1925 - April 8th, 2016
McGoldrick, Charlotte M., 90 of Sun City Center, Fla. She peacefully went home to God on April 8, 2016. She was born August 2, 1925 in New York City, NY and was preceded in death by her husband, Richard McGoldrick. She is survived by her nieces, nephews, cousins and friends, who remember fondly all of the pre-Christmas celebrations with Rich and Charlotte, and are grateful for the memories. Charlotte was a faithful participant at Our Lady of Guadalupe Catholic Church and had been an avid golfer and bridge player until a few years ago. She loved living at Aston Gardens and went to many baseball games. She lived life as fully as she could and never complained about any health problems she had. Charlotte loved animals, especially dogs. Anyone wishing to make a contribution in her memory, please send it to Critter Adoption and Rescue, Inc.
